Abstract

Oral buccal tablet is made by five kinds of medicament grind into powder compression of following mass parts in the bactericide taken after a kind of swimming, and five kinds of medicaments are:Radix scutellariae 20 40, Fructus Forsythiae 14 25, cassia twig 30 60, akebi 15 30, Chinese violet 20 35, invention bactericide have stronger killing effect for the main pathogenic bacteria in swimming pool, can effectively kill the bacterium removed into oral cavity, esophagus.

Description

A kind of bactericide taken after swimming
Technical field
The present invention relates to the bactericides taken after a kind of swimming.
Technical background
Seem clean actually and unholiness into the water investigated and found in lido is crossed, although being carried out by chlorinated product Disinfection, but still suffers from a large amount of pathogenic bacteria in water, if pseudomonad can allow you to suffer from pustular eruption, Legionnella can allow you have a fever and Cough, Shiga bacillus, norwalk virus and Escherichia coli can allow your diarrhea.
Always more or less in swimming to drink into certain swimming-pool water, these pathogenic bacteria will enter human body, to human body Health causes damages.
Invention content
In view of the above-mentioned problems, the present invention provides the bactericide taken after a kind of swimming, the medicament is for the master in swimming pool Pathogenic bacteria are wanted to have stronger killing effect.
The technical proposal of the invention is realized in this way:The bactericide taken after a kind of swimming is by five kinds of following mass parts Oral buccal tablet is made in the compression of medicament grind into powder, and five kinds of medicaments are:Radix scutellariae 20-40, Fructus Forsythiae 14-25, cassia twig 30-60, akebi 15-30, Chinese violet 20-35.
Specific implementation mode:
The bactericide taken after a kind of swimming is soaked in the distilled water that mass parts are 400-500 by five kinds of medicaments of following mass parts In 30 days or more soaks formed, five kinds of medicaments are:Radix scutellariae 20-40, Fructus Forsythiae 14-25, cassia twig 30-60, akebi 15-30, Chinese violet 20-35.
Several preferred embodiments of this drug are given below.
Radix scutellariae 20, Fructus Forsythiae 14, cassia twig 30, akebi 15, Chinese violet 20.
Radix scutellariae 30, Fructus Forsythiae 18, cassia twig 45, akebi 22, Chinese violet 27.
Radix scutellariae 40, Fructus Forsythiae 25, cassia twig 60, akebi 30, Chinese violet 35.
The proportionate relationship of above-mentioned mass parts namely a component.
Application method:Swimming half an hour after takes this medicament, two every time.
The characteristics of introducing each component individually below and control effect and mechanism.
Radix scutellariae:Degerming spectrum is wider, to corynebacterium diphtheriae common in swimming pool, tubercle bacillus, comma bacillus, shigella dysenteriae and white Color candida albicans has inhibiting effect.
Fructus Forsythiae:Bitter is slightly cold.There are clearing heat and detoxicating, dispersing swelling and dissipating binds.Principle active component is Flavonol glycoside, this product There are powerful antiinflammatory and bacteriostatic functions, can effectively kill into the bacterium in esophagus.
Cassia twig:With anti-inflammatory antiallergy, antibacterial, antivirus action, to staphylococcus albus, Shigella shigae, wound Cold and paratyphoid A bacillus, pneumococcus, aerobacteria, proteus, bacillus anthracis, Bacterium enteritidis, comma bacillus etc. Also there is inhibiting effect, can effectively kill except the pathogenic bacteria in the esophagus of oral cavity.
Akebi:There is inhibiting effect to gram positive bacteria and gram negative bacilli such as shigella dysenteriae, typhoid bacillus.To violet Trichophyta also has different degrees of bacteriostasis.
Chinese violet:The glycosides displayed contained has very strong killing to make staphylococcus aureus, staphylococcus albus, proteus With.
